Honestly all of the major OEMs, with the exception of Toyota, are going to be in a world of hurt. They paid more attention to politics than their customers and went all in on EVs, forgetting that the governments of the world don’t buy their products. Now they are all desperately trying to walk back their overly optimistic EV sales predictions while trying to cobble together ICE and hybrid products that people will actually buy. For instance Porsche has already said there will likely be a ICE Macan after previously introducing their newest model as EV only. Meanwhile Toyota, who has said all along that hybrids and ICE are the answer, keeps plugging away.

https://media.ford.com/content/fordmedia/fna/us/en/news/2025/01/03/fourth-quarter-full-year-sales.html
Ford Motor Company U.S. retail sales gain 17% in Q4, driving full-year 2024 retail gains of 6% - twice the rate of the estimated overall retail industry Total Ford electrified vehicle sales (hybrid, plug-in hybrid and electric) hit a record 285,291 this year – up 38%, outselling GM and Stellantis’ electrified vehicles for the full year Ford No. 1 in hybrid trucks with an estimated 76% segment share and No. 2 U.S. electric vehicle brand F-Series remains America’s best-selling truck for 48th straight year Lincoln delivers best annual retail sales in 17 years Ford Pro Intelligence software platform subscriptions, based on end-of-quarter estimates, up about 27% year-over-year Entering 2025, Ford bolstered its vehicle inventory to help offset the impact of expected supply reductions during plant changeovers for key product launches, including the new Expedition, Navigator and Bronco. The move reflects Ford’s strategy to keep its product lineup among the freshest in the industry for customers and dealers. Strong Bronco, Expedition Sales; Explorer – America’s Best-Selling Three-Row SUV For the year, Ford Explorer sales totaled 194,094 SUVs making it America’s best-selling three-row SUV. Sales of Ford’s Expedition were up 6% on sales of 78,035, with the all-new Expedition ready to launch in Q1 of 2025. For the year, overall Ford SUV sales totaled 771,042; Bronco family totaled 233,873 for the year with a strong year-end performance with Q4 sales up 38% on 62,568 Broncos and Bronco Sports sold.
